Event between (555758) 14DP143 and star GA0820:04731146 with event index number of 2472072
Geocentric closest approach at 2023/04/15 00:09:55 UTC
J2000 position of star is 15:24:32.7 -06:10:25
Equinox of date position of star is 15:25:45.3 -06:15:10
Stellar brightness G=16.1,
use SENSEUP=128 with the MallinCam and and exposure
time of 2 seconds with the QHY174 camera.
Star is 87 degrees from the moon.
Moon is 32% illuminated.
TNO apparent brightness V=22.4
TNO is 29.3 AU from the Sun
and 28.4 AU from the Earth.
The TNO is moving 21.4
km/sec on the sky relative to the star, or,
3.7 arcsec/hr.
The 1-sigma error in the time of the event is 101 seconds.
The 1-sigma cross-track error in the shadow position is
1376 km.
The TNO has an absolute magnitude Hv=7.7
Diameter=175.4 km assuming a 5% albedo -- 8.3 sec chord
Diameter=71.6 km assuming a 30% albedo -- 3.4 sec chord
Dynamical classification is 3:2E
